First, let’s talk about the anatomy of a small dog’s voice box. Unlike their larger counterparts, small dogs have shorter vocal cords that vibrate at a higher frequency, producing a sharp, piercing bark. Additionally, their small size means they have a smaller lung capacity, forcing them to take quick, shallow breaths that also add to the intensity of their barks.

But it’s not just about physical attributes. Small dogs are often bred to be watchdogs, with a fierce and protective nature that is reflected in their barks. They may be small in size, but they have big personalities and aren’t afraid to let the world know.
